Methods: A total of 60 patients with acute exacerbation of COPD admitted between September 2022 and September 2023 were selected and randomly grouped into a control group (conventional care and treatment) and an observation group (joint interventions: traditional Chinese medicine nursing interventions, acupoint compresses), with 30 patients each. The arterial blood gas indexes of the two groups, hospitalization time, pulmonary function indexes, and TCM symptom scores were analyzed and compared between the two groups. Results: The arterial oxygen pressure (PaO2) (9.52 ± 1.02 kPa) and partial pressure of carbon dioxide (PaCO2) (5.01 ± 1.02 kPa) of the observation group were better than those of the control group after the intervention (P &amp;lt; 0.05). The forced expiratory volume (FEV1) (3.38 ± 0.15%), the FEV1% prediction value (72.52 ± 2.25), and the FEV1/ forced vital capacity (FVC) (79.52 ± 1.41%) were higher than those of the control group (P &amp;lt; 0.05). The hospitalization time (12.16 ± 1.02 d) and TCM symptom score (4.12 ± 1.26) of the observation group were better than those of the control group (P &amp;lt; 0.05).
